Insulation Thickness and R-Value
In examining the performance of any kind of insulation, two essential aspects enter into play: insulation density and R-value. The R-value gauges the resistance of warmth flow via the insulation, with greater values showing exceptional performance. Spray foam insulation usually has a higher R-value per inch than various other protecting materials. This implies that much less density is required to achieve the exact same thermal efficiency. It not only saves area however also decreases building costs. In addition, spray foam insulation expands once installed, filling spaces and creating a more reliable obstacle versus warmth loss. This special high quality more enhances its R-value, making it a superb option for modern-day structures seeking energy effectiveness and premium thermal efficiency.

Optimizing Thermal Performance
To achieve optimum thermal efficiency in modern-day buildings, spray foam insulation is an excellent option. This insulation kind is known for its exceptional capacity to obstruct heat transfer, which is type in maintaining a constant indoor temperature level year-round. Unlike standard insulation products, spray foam increases upon setup, filling spaces and creating a limited seal. This prevents thermal linking, a common issue where heat leaves with uninsulated areas of the structure envelope. By lessening warmth loss and gain, spray foam insulation enhances the building's thermal efficiency, reducing the stress on heating and cooling down systems. Developing Healthier and Quieter Spaces With Spray Foam Insulation
Spray foam insulation uses greater than just thermal advantages; it also substantially adds to developing healthier and quieter areas. By providing an airtight seal, spray foam insulation reduces the seepage of outdoor allergens and toxins, therefore enhancing interior air high quality. Its thick structure likewise discourages the development of mold and mildew and mildew, more improving the healthfulness of the atmosphere. In addition, spray foam insulation has sound-dampening top Our site qualities. Its ability to fill gaps and holes causes a barrier that effectively reduces sound transmission in between walls and floors, using owners a quieter, extra peaceful living or working room. Therefore, considering its wellness and acoustic benefits, spray foam insulation shows to be a superior selection for modern structure services.
